I have been cutting for 4 months. After a LGD-4033 and MK-677 stacked bulk I was 205lbs. I’m 5’9” so that was a bit hefty. I am currently at 185 and planning to stop my cut around 175-180.

What is the best way to end a cut and transition to a bulking cycle again? I’m currently eating about 1700cals (final push) and targeting >150g protein per day.

I'd suggest a period of maintenance before jumping back into a bulk. Maintenance can actually be super challenging for some dudes, but it's an incredibly useful skill to build.

What Today said. Insert a 4-6 week maintenance period in-between. It helps reduce fat gain when transitioning to a bulk, and muscle loss when transitioning to a cut.

Well first off you need to up your protein to atleast 1-1.5 g per lb.
I’ll go against the grain and say you don’t need to really wait to increase cals.
The only time I recommend really holding maintenance calories is from a bulk to cut. Just up them progressively around 200-400 every 2weeks. As you gain weight up your protein.
I will makes a suggestion to base your maintenance calories off of your estimated lean body mass not scale weight.
